    Quote Originally Posted by MrFTAMan View Post
    Do I need to skew? If so, please tell me how to.
    thanks
    Skew on the Channel Master round dishes is easy. You just loosen the two bolts holding the feedhorn in place and twist the feedhorn left or right. Use a receiver/TV monitor to maximize your quality, then tighten down the two bolts.
